diff --git a/electrum/gui/qml/components/BalanceDetails.qml b/electrum/gui/qml/components/BalanceDetails.qml index cc4073deb..db15329f8 100644 --- a/electrum/gui/qml/components/BalanceDetails.qml +++ b/electrum/gui/qml/components/BalanceDetails.qml @@ -35,6 +35,16 @@ Pane { width: parent.width spacing: constants.paddingLarge + InfoTextArea { + Layout.fillWidth: true + Layout.bottomMargin: constants.paddingLarge + visible: Daemon.currentWallet.synchronizing || Network.server_status != 'connected' + text: Daemon.currentWallet.synchronizing + ? qsTr('Your wallet is not synchronized. The displayed balance may be inaccurate.') + : qsTr('Your wallet is not connected to an Electrum server. The displayed balance may be outdated.') + iconStyle: InfoTextArea.IconStyle.Warn + } + Heading { text: qsTr('Wallet balance') } diff --git a/electrum/gui/qml/components/controls/BalanceSummary.qml b/electrum/gui/qml/components/controls/BalanceSummary.qml index cef653dc6..f1437f870 100644 --- a/electrum/gui/qml/components/controls/BalanceSummary.qml +++ b/electrum/gui/qml/components/controls/BalanceSummary.qml @@ -147,7 +147,6 @@ Item { MouseArea { anchors.fill: parent onClicked: { - if(Daemon.currentWallet.synchronizing || Network.server_status != 'connected') return app.stack.push(Qt.resolvedUrl('../BalanceDetails.qml')) } }